TYT 8000lbs Square Direct Weld Heavy Duty Trailer Jack, 15 Inche…
Rating: 105 reviews from 1 sources
Reviews
Selected Review of 105 Reviews
very well made and not hard to install at all. Like the amount of weight it can withstand. Shold last for a long time. … Read full review
www.amazon.com